Ousmane Dembélé Fit for Big-Match Return as Paris Saint‑Germain Prepare to Face Bayern Munich

Luis Enrique has confirmed that Ousmane Dembélé is ready for selection ahead of Paris Saint-Germain’s crucial UEFA Champions League group-stage showdown with Bayern Munich, saying the French forward has completed every training session in the past two weeks and is fully fit. 

 

Dembélé, who suffered a right-thigh/hamstring concern while on international duty with France, had featured only 18 minutes in PSG’s recent Ligue 1 match against Nice. 

 

 The club, however, elected to pause risk-taking and monitor his recovery, with Enrique making clear they would not rush his return. “We do not take risks with any players. But Ousmane Dembélé is fit, he has been in every training session for the last two weeks,” Enrique stated. “He will certainly play tomorrow. I do not know for how many minutes, but he is ready to compete.” 


The timing of Dembélé’s return is significant. PSG face Bayern Munich with both clubs unbeaten in the Champions League so far this season, and the stakes are high: victory will give one side a decisive edge in the group. Bayern have also just won 15 games in a row across all competitions. 

 

For PSG, Dembélé brings pace, dribbling and versatility to an attack needing impact against a Bayern side that can dominate with structure and efficiency. His availability offers Enrique more tactical options at a moment when small margins will decide the duel.
